A simultaneous analysis method of sunscreen agents is provided to ensure reproducibility, accuracy, reduction of screening time and convenience, to detect sunscreen agents present in cosmetic materials and to analyze compounds having lipophilic property and hydrophile property at the same time. A simultaneous analysis method of sunscreen agents comprises the steps of (i) extracting lipophilic and hydrophilic sunscreen components by adding the solution mixed with dimethylformamide and methanol in a volume ratio of 1 : 0.9-1.2 to cosmetic materials having lipophilic and hydrophilic sunscreen components; (ii) injecting lipophilic and hydrophilic sunscreen components in a reverse-phase non-polar column filled with octadecylsilane(C18), dodecylsilane(C12) or octasilane(C8) having non-polar as a fixed bed; and (iii) performing quantitative analysis and qualitative analysis of lipophilic and hydrophilic sunscreen components with liquid chromatography by using the mixed solution of water and ethanol, or ethanol as a mobile phase.

Provided is a method for stabilizing benzamide compounds to manufacture skin medicines for external use, including the benzamide compounds as an active ingredient without any structure changes. A composition of skin medicines for external use has pH of 5 or less. Benzamide compounds of which a substituted group is not decomposed exists within the composition. The benzamide compounds are selected from the group consisting of 3,5-dihydroxy-N-(4-hydroxyphenyl)benzamide, N-Phenylbenzamide, t-butylbenzamido hydroxybenzamide, 2-hydroxy-N-phenylbenzamide, and t-butylbenzamido methylhydroxybenzamide.

PURPOSE: Provided are a stabilization method of active ingredients inside hydrophobic polymer by increasing solubility of the active ingredients and using polyol/polymer microcapsules and a cosmetic composition containing the microcapsules to maximize its efficacy. CONSTITUTION: The method for manufacturing polyol/polymer microcapsules comprises the steps of: dissolving at least one kind of active ingredient selected from the group consisting of water soluble or insoluble active ingredients in polyol/solvent; dispersing the solution and emulsifying it to give emulsion; and removing the polyol/solvent from the emulsion and recovering hard polymer microcapsules.
